Transaction 3c4ccc0dc172571452932da02fe1827de1050b57697e59ba6e18e5f1d7bddf0e
1 Input
1 Output
-
3c4ccc0dc172571452932da02fe1827de1050b57697e59ba6e18e5f1d7bddf0e:0
- value
- 39724787738
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 ea97402adbca57e9502c2751f7ba8ff460baf474 OP_EQUALVERIFY OP_CHECKSIG
- address
- DSXVrE5yGESwmRJmDRZtUjy7yh3zt7qzZX